As nouns the difference between brunch and offshoot
is that brunch is a meal eaten later in the day than breakfast and earlier than lunch, and often consisting of some foods that would normally be eaten at breakfast and some foods that would normally be eaten at lunch while offshoot is that which shoots off or separates from a main stem, channel, family, race, etc.; as, the offshoots of a tree.
As a verb brunch
is to eat brunch.
